Returning favorites seem all the rage in the TV categories for this year's Screen Actors Guild Awards. 30 Rock is the comedy front-runner, and Mad Men might coast on its wins at the Emmys and Golden Globes to take home SAG statues for its second season. But don't count out the newcomers. Back Stage spoke with TV critics Robert Bianco of USA Today, Ray Richmond of The Hollywood Reporter, and Michael Ausiello of Entertainment Weekly to get their takes on the upcoming nominations.

Outstanding Performance by a Female Actor in a Drama Series
Even though last year's SAG winner, Edie Falco of The Sopranos, and this year's Emmy winner, Glenn Close of Damages, are not in the running — there were no new episodes of the FX series during the SAG eligibility period — there is still an "embarrassment of riches" from which to choose, according to Richmond. It includes Kyra Sedgwick of The Closer, Holly Hunter of Saving Grace, Ellen Pompeo of Grey's Anatomy, Sally Field of Brothers & Sisters, and Patricia Arquette of Medium. Richmond says we are in "a golden age for TV drama."

Richmond and Ausiello would also like to see some of the women from Mad Men in this category, including January Jones and Elisabeth Moss. Jones has "just been on fire this season," says Ausiello. Connie Britton of Friday Night Lights is another long-overlooked performer, but like her male co-star, she'll probably be ignored again. Lisa Edelstein of House is another one Bianco likes. Featured performers such as Sandra Oh and Chandra Wilson of Grey's Anatomy could also figure prominently.

Richmond praises Katey Sagal for departing from sitcoms (Married With Children) and animation (Futurama) to do FX's biker drama Sons of Anarchy. He says her performance is "the best thing she's ever done."
